Arsenal are readying themselves for a summer of interest and speculation over the future of Wales international Aaron Ramsey reports the Daily Mirror.

The 27-year-old’s contract expires in 2019 and the situation hasn’t gone unnoticed among Europe’s top clubs. With the Gunners further than ever away from qualifying for the Champions League, Arsenal know the midfielder is on the shopping list of the elite.

Latest among them is Juventus. While the Bianconeri remain focused on Liverpool midfielder Emre Can, 25, talks have stalled with the Germany international refusing to discuss his future until the season is over.

It’s left the soon-to-be-crowned Serie A champions needing a Plan B; Ramsey with nine goals and 19 assists in all competitions this season offers a genuinely different solution to their midfield aspirations.

Arsenal are currently in talks with his representatives and remain convinced Ramsey will prolong his stay at the Emirates. However, his value is likely to drop after this summer so a ‘sign or be sold’ situation is emerging.

The Gunners held onto Alexis Sanchez, 30, in similar circumstances and ended up losing around £30m in cash when he moved to Old Trafford in a swap deal which saw 29-year-old Henrikh Mkhitaryan go to north London.

Arsenal prefer Ramsey to sign a new deal but face an uphill struggle to convince him to accept a deal worth less than the £200,000 per week Mkhitaryan and the other winter signing,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ang, 29, earn.
